571.40 - Purpose and scope.
An inmate may file a petition for commutation of sentence in accordance with the provisions of 28 CFR part 1.
(a) An inmate may request from the inmate's case manager the appropriate forms (and instructions) for filing a petition for commutation of sentence.
(b) When specifically requested by the U.S. Pardon Attorney, the Director, Bureau of Prisons will forward a recommendation on the inmate's petition for commutation of sentence.
[47 FR 9756, Mar. 5, 1982]
